Historic Frogmore Paper Mill offers many options for those wishing to try their hand at learning a new art form, extend existing skills or for professional development. We offer adult creative courses, childrens art activities, untutored drawing sessions for life and portrait, a gallery and hands-on papermaking with Two Rivers Paper. Our courses are delivered by highly experienced, well qualified

and friendly tutors. Class sizes tend to be small and personal.

'The Peter Ingram Gallery', Hertfordshire's newest gallery has since November 2011 featured a variety of displays including Herts Open Studio mixed show, 'Paper Wedding' which included a wedding dress made out of nothing more than paper and 'Lifers and Mugger' as group show from our drawing participants.
